Electrical oscillations are initiated in a series circuit containing a capacitance C, inductance L, and resistance R.
(a) If R << √4L/C (weak damping), how much time elapses before the amplitude of the current oscillation falls off to 50.0% of its initial value?
(b) How long does it take the energy to decrease to 50.0% of its initial value?
